🪰 Tiny, tough, and thriving in tar! Meet the petroleum fly, the only known insect whose entire life cycle unfolds in asphalt. Get a closer look at these extreme survivors found at the #TarPits: bit.ly/TinyToughTar

Among the thousands of dire wolf specimens at La Brea #TarPits is this 𝘈𝘦𝘯𝘰𝘤𝘺𝘰𝘯 𝘥𝘪𝘳𝘶𝘴 lower jaw. Known as “The Endling”—the last known #direwolf fossil on Earth—this fossil is dated to be approximately 13,082 years old. See the fossil now on view in our Fossil Lab!

Aenocyon dirus lower jaw fossil (approximately 13,082 years old) on view at La Brea Tar Pits & Museum. Photo courtesy of Tyler Hayden.

Why did the Ice Age titans go extinct? Using a method devised for dating fossils preserved in asphalt, a team of 19 scientists obtained over 170 radiocarbon dates on #TarPits fossils. This helped determine when different species disappeared from the ecosystem and start to ask: why?

Drs. Regan Dunn and Emily Lindsey display two large fossils from the La Brea Tar Pits. UCLA PhD candidate Lisa Martinez examines charcoal from the bottom of Lake Elsinore to chronicle the story of Ice Age fire in Southern California. Clearest picture yet of the megafauna extinctions at the Tar Pits established through innovative carbon dating techniques.
